Input validation vulnerability in WPZOOM Shortcodes 1.0.1

The WPZOOM Shortcodes plugin for WordPress has a security issue that could allow harmful code to be added to webpages. This can happen if someone without proper authorization tricks a user into clicking on a link.

Detected in:

WPZOOM Shortcodes open vulnerable versions: >= * <= 1.0.1
